How not to apologize

by: WVaBlue

Mon Aug 17, 2009 at 09:14:21 AM EDT


By Carnacki and Clem Guttata

After offending many of his fellow West Virginia Young Democrats last week by forwarding along the email without comment about Don Blankenship's anti-environment, anti-labor, anti-Democratic Party rally in West Virginia, Justin Marcum, chairman of the Labor Caucus and president of Mingo County Young Democrats, received criticism and questions from several WVYD labor caucus members.

Instead of apologizing he wrote:

I was not intending to offend any of you about the Coal News messages. It showcased our event and that is why I sent it out. Furthermore, I do not support the Friends of America rally but think its educational for everyone to see what is being said. Also, this is not a coal caucus, I am currently working on things for the teachers and their unions. Lastly, the messages were not the views of the labor caucus or anyone in it; just an informative message for all to see what is being said.

I understand that the message came across the wrong way but this caucus nor myself is pushing any kind of an agenda in the direction of the newsletter. Moreover, I understand that we must focus on other issues of labor within the State. Labor unions are the backbone of this State and America and I sincerely regret the misinformation that could have been construed the wrong way. Lastly, I am interested in working through this caucus to help Matt Sowards and the rest of WVYD with the healthcare issue. I am also interested in working on something for the teachers. Please feel free to help me with this issue and once again, I sincerely regret the way each of you viewed the message I sent out a few days ago.

In other words, he does not regret he sent it. He regrets that people took umbrage. It's wrong how they viewed the message and not that he sent it.

Party leadership responsibilities (4.00 / 3)
There are multiple activist organizations with formal ties to the Democratic National Committee. The Young Democrats organization is one. Because of their formal ties, they get automatic seats at conventions and other party benefits like that.

I believe if you are an officer in an organization affiliated with the DNC, you have a responsibility to support the Democratic President, to support the major tenets of the Democratic Party Platform, and to support party-building efforts. That does not mean you need to personally agree on every issue, but it does mean you have a responsibility not to actively aid those seeking to undermine the Democratic party.

A strength of the Democratic Party is our openness to diversity--we try to build a big tent. I would never tell anyone to leave the party over disagreements with President Obama or the Democratic party platform (there's plenty of issues where my views differ!). We'll never all agree on every issue (nor should we).

But, if someone is in a leadership position in the party, and they don't feel personally comfortable supporting major Democratic legislative and presidential initiatives, they just might want to reconsider if party leadership is the right place for them.
